Action item: The Relayn deploy-status bot silently dropped updates when the pipeline API paginated results, so responders believed a rollback had completed when it had not. We will add pagination handling, a staleness banner, and an integration test. Until merged, verify deploy state directly in the pipeline console, documented at the page below.

runbook for kahop-kajop: https://rundeck.ordinio.test/display/secrets/pipeline/issue/pages/repo/browse/e5732776e07d1285107e5aeb

- [ ] **Step 7: Breaker override escrow.** After sealing the signing keys for the Tallgrove upstream API circuit breaker, confirm the support team can force the breaker open during a full outage. The override bundle lives in the sealed escrow drawer and is useless without its unlock phrase. Two ceremony witnesses must initial this step before proceeding. The escrow bundle is decrypted with the recovery passphrase that follows.

vault phrase of kahip-kahop = holath-quenmir

Minutes — Management Meeting, Gross-Margin Review

Attendees: R. Velloway (chair), branch managers. Q3 gross margin slipped to 31.2%, driven by discounting at the Harlowe Street and Dunmire branches. Freight recovery improved slightly. Agreed actions: tighten discount approvals above 10%, review supplier rebates with Corvane Goods, and standardise markdown reporting. Branch managers to submit margin plans by month-end. The confidential outlook for next year follows below.

internal memo for kawip-hadug: Headcount on the Wenwyn team goes from 7 to 140 by the end of January. Gross margin on Wenwyn came in at 20 percent against a plan of 15 percent.